Academic Achievements
Published numerous papers on spectral theory of random matrices, quantum unique ergodicity, eigenvalue distributions in neural network kernels, etc.
Notable works include: 'Convergence of local eigenvector processes of generalized Wigner matrices' (2025, with M. Rezaei)
'Eigenvalue distribution of the Neural Tangent Kernel in the quadratic scaling' (2025, with E. Paquette)
'Fluctuations of eigenvector overlaps and the Berry conjecture for Wigner matrices' (2024, Electron. J. Probab)
'Fluctuations in local quantum unique ergodicity for generalized Wigner matrices' (2022, Comm. Math. Phys)
'Optimal delocalization for generalized Wigner matrices' (2022, Adv. Math)
'Eigenvalue distribution of nonlinear models of random matrices' (2021, with S. Péché, Electron. J. Probab)
'Eigenvectors distribution and quantum unique ergodicity for deformed Wigner matrices' (2020, Ann. Inst. Henri Poincaré)
'Hausdorff dimension of the record set of a fractional Brownian motion' (2018, with C. Cosco et al., Electron. Commun. Probab)
